Transaction 644423b3fc7729e97b087a977c834341a8a5bdcd2a4edc9d039b0fa76c1ccc47

1 Input
2 Outputs
  • 644423b3fc7729e97b087a977c834341a8a5bdcd2a4edc9d039b0fa76c1ccc47:0
  • value  79000
    address  3MEHg3WnuAqBZEhRcRvTPSWBHjmXdKTpLx
  • 644423b3fc7729e97b087a977c834341a8a5bdcd2a4edc9d039b0fa76c1ccc47:1
  • value  563543
    address  1KFrFP6fdSWXiBJMEWWTk5rioRxUAGpi4W